> Shall we mark the older repositories for the above [1][2][3] as obsolete
> since they are now distributed among the product teams? There are pull
> requests being opened and issues being created for them that should be done
> at either the product specific repositories or each *-common repository.
>
> We shouldn't remove them yet, IMO, since there haven't been any product
> stack wide release for any of the above artifacts. AFAIK only IS and APIM
> has release product specific Puppet modules. Once a release is done for
> every product, we could remove the older repositories however for now, we
> should mark them as obsolete and direct to proper new repositories for any
> new user to discover and interact with the new code.
